7 Cutting-Edge Scikit Learn Books To Read in 2025

Discover new Scikit Learn books by Cuantum Technologies, THOMPSON CARTER, and more, authored by leading experts shaping AI in 2025.

Updated on June 26, 2025
We may earn commissions for purchases made via this page

The Scikit Learn landscape changed dramatically in 2024, with fresh approaches redefining feature engineering, model tuning, and domain-specific applications. As machine learning grows indispensable across industries, these new books capture the pulse of 2025, offering readers access to emerging techniques that push Scikit Learn beyond basics.

Authored by forward-thinking experts like Cuantum Technologies and THOMPSON CARTER, these works combine practical code examples with insights into complex algorithms and real-world implementation. Their fresh perspectives address the evolving challenges practitioners face, from finance to healthcare, making them authoritative resources for anyone serious about mastering machine learning.

While these cutting-edge books provide the latest insights, readers seeking the newest content tailored to their specific Scikit Learn goals might consider creating a personalized Scikit Learn book that builds on these emerging trends, ensuring you stay ahead in this fast-moving field.

Best for advanced feature engineering techniques
Cuantum Technologies is dedicated to harnessing technology for societal advancement and focuses on empowering individuals through education and innovative tools. Their expertise shapes this book into a guide for advanced feature engineering using Scikit-Learn, designed to help you build efficient workflows and tackle real-world machine learning challenges with confidence.
2024·436 pages·Feature Extraction, Scikit Learn, Machine Learning, Data Science, Feature Engineering

What if everything you knew about feature engineering was reexamined through the lens of modern machine learning? Cuantum Technologies challenges traditional approaches by focusing on automation and domain-specific applications using Scikit-Learn pipelines. You’ll learn not only foundational transformations like scaling and encoding but also advanced techniques such as polynomial features, interaction terms, and dimensionality reduction. The book dives into practical case studies from healthcare to retail, illustrating how to tailor feature engineering for varied data challenges. If you’re looking to boost your machine learning models through precise, reproducible workflows, this guide gives you the tools and examples to build on your existing skills.

View on Amazon
Best for Python developers mastering ML
Practical Machine Learning with Python and Scikit-Learn stands out by focusing on the latest developments in machine learning through the lens of Python programming. This book covers everything from essential libraries like Pandas and Matplotlib to advanced topics like neural networks and hyperparameter tuning, providing a clear, structured approach to building intelligent models. It’s designed for developers and data scientists eager to apply Scikit-Learn’s capabilities to real-world challenges, whether forecasting stock prices or classifying customer data. By addressing common pitfalls such as overfitting and imbalanced datasets, it equips you to elevate your projects with precision and confidence.
2024·324 pages·Machine Learning Model, Scikit Learn, Machine Learning, Data Science, Python Programming

What happens when a developer with a passion for Python takes on machine learning? Thompson Carter crafted this guide to bridge the gap between coding fluency and practical machine learning mastery using Scikit-Learn. You’ll explore not just the basics like Pandas and Numpy, but also dive into hyperparameter tuning, neural networks, and unsupervised learning with hands-on code examples. Chapters walk you through handling data quirks, model evaluation, and integrating TensorFlow, equipping you with skills to tackle real-world problems like stock prediction or customer classification. If you want to sharpen your Python skills specifically for impactful machine learning projects, this book offers focused insights without fluff.

View on Amazon
Best for custom learning paths
This AI-created book on Scikit Learn is crafted based on your background and specific interests in the latest 2025 advances. You share what new techniques and areas you want to focus on, and it delivers a book that matches your goals perfectly. By tailoring the content to your needs, it helps you engage deeply with emerging insights and stay ahead in this fast-evolving field.
2025·50-300 pages·Scikit Learn, Machine Learning, Feature Engineering, Model Optimization, Algorithm Advances

This personalized AI book delves into the dynamic world of Scikit Learn advances emerging in 2025, tailored specifically to your experience and interests. It explores the latest developments in machine learning algorithms, novel feature engineering techniques, and cutting-edge model optimization methods that are reshaping the landscape. By focusing on your unique background and goals, the book guides you through contemporary challenges and evolving practices, enabling a deep understanding of new discoveries. It reveals how recent research and tools integrate into practical workflows, helping you stay informed and adept in this rapidly advancing field. This tailored approach ensures learning is both relevant and immediately applicable to your pursuits.

Tailored Content
Algorithm Innovation
3,000+ Books Generated
Best for deep practical understanding
"Scikit-Learn: A Detailed Overview" offers a thorough exploration of one of Python's most versatile machine learning libraries, capturing the latest developments and practical approaches in the field. Mikhail Agladze presents foundational concepts alongside advanced topics like model selection and hyperparameter tuning, providing a framework that benefits both beginners and seasoned practitioners. The book tackles the challenge of simplifying complex algorithms and data transformations, making it a valuable reference for anyone aiming to leverage Scikit Learn effectively in their projects. Its balanced mix of theory and application addresses the evolving needs of data scientists navigating today's fast-changing AI landscape.
2024·573 pages·Scikit Learn, Machine Learning, Data Science, Model Evaluation, Supervised Learning

The research behind this book reveals how Scikit-Learn remains a cornerstone for both novices and experts in machine learning. Mikhail Agladze carefully breaks down complex algorithms and workflows into accessible segments, guiding you through data preprocessing, model building, and evaluation with clarity. You'll find detailed chapters dedicated to supervised and unsupervised learning techniques, model selection strategies, and hyperparameter tuning, making it clear what each step accomplishes. This book suits anyone eager to deepen their practical understanding of machine learning using Python's powerful library, especially those who prefer a blend of theory and hands-on application without unnecessary jargon.

View on Amazon
Best for building intelligent systems
This book offers a practical approach to mastering machine learning with Python, focusing on the popular Scikit Learn library and TensorFlow. It covers the latest developments in data preprocessing, model evaluation, and deployment, supported by numerous hands-on code examples. Designed for practitioners aiming to build intelligent systems, it addresses the need for actionable skills in developing and deploying machine learning models using current Python tools and libraries.
2024·223 pages·Scikit Learn, Machine Learning, Python, Deep Learning, TensorFlow

What started as a need to demystify machine learning for practitioners has resulted in a hands-on exploration of Python's capabilities for building intelligent systems. Nexus AI guides you through core concepts, from data preprocessing to deep learning with TensorFlow, emphasizing practical application through abundant code examples. You'll gain clear insights into model evaluation and deployment, making it easier to translate theory into working solutions. This book suits developers and data scientists eager to deepen their programming skills in machine learning, especially those wanting a bridge between foundational knowledge and advanced techniques.

View on Amazon
Best for finance-focused ML practitioners
This book offers a unique bridge between machine learning and finance by focusing on practical implementation using scikit-learn. It captures emerging trends in financial technology by providing clear, step-by-step examples that range from basic algorithms to advanced model tuning. Designed to help finance professionals and data scientists alike, it addresses the need for tools that translate machine learning theory into actionable financial insights. Its resource-rich approach, including datasets and code, empowers you to directly apply techniques to problems like fraud detection and portfolio optimization, making it a valuable addition to the evolving field of financial analytics.
Machine Learning: Scikit Lean for Finance (Python Libraries for Finance) book cover

by Hayden Van Der Post, Reactive Publishing·You?

2024·470 pages·Finance, Scikit Learn, Machine Learning, Regression, Classification

While working as a finance professional, Hayden Van Der Post noticed a gap between theoretical machine learning concepts and their practical use in financial contexts. This book guides you through implementing machine learning models with scikit-learn specifically tailored for finance, covering regression, classification, clustering, and advanced techniques like ensemble methods. You’ll gain hands-on experience with detailed code examples for tasks such as stock price prediction and portfolio optimization. If you're aiming to apply machine learning directly to financial data, this book offers clear instruction and real-world frameworks to build your skills effectively.

View on Amazon
Best for future-ready learning plans
This personalized AI book about Scikit Learn is created based on your evolving interest and skill level in machine learning. You share which upcoming trends and subtopics you want to explore, and the book is crafted to focus on those future-focused areas. By tailoring the content, it helps you navigate new discoveries and prepare a machine learning plan that matches your goals specifically rather than a generic overview.
2025·50-300 pages·Scikit Learn, Machine Learning, Model Optimization, Feature Selection, API Updates

This tailored book explores emerging trends and discoveries set to shape Scikit Learn through 2025 and beyond. It examines the newest developments in machine learning algorithms, model optimization techniques, and domain-specific applications, all curated to match your background and specific interests. By focusing on your goals, the book reveals cutting-edge insights and research breakthroughs that are most relevant to your learning journey. With a personalized approach, it guides you through advanced topics like automated feature selection, evolving API changes, and novel integration methods, making sure you stay well-informed and prepared for tomorrow’s challenges in machine learning with Scikit Learn.

Tailored Content
Algorithm Trends
3,000+ Books Created
Best for predictive modeling mastery
Parag Saxena is a renowned expert in machine learning and data science with extensive experience in predictive modeling applications. His focus on practical applications using Python and Scikit-Learn drives this book, which brings hands-on learning to complex machine learning concepts, making them accessible for professionals aiming to build cutting-edge predictive models.
2024·393 pages·Predictive Modeling, Scikit Learn, Machine Learning, Data Preprocessing, Logistic Regression

When Parag Saxena discovered the practical challenges of integrating diverse data types into predictive models, he crafted this book to bridge theory with application using Python and Scikit-Learn. You’ll learn how to preprocess data meticulously, from linear regression foundations to handling complex unstructured and real-time data streams. Topics like anomaly detection with isolation forests and ensemble methods for stock market analysis offer concrete examples that sharpen your modeling toolkit. This book suits data scientists and developers ready to deepen their mastery of machine learning pipelines and predictive analytics without getting lost in abstract theory.

View on Amazon
Best for concise hands-on learning
"Scikit-Learn Mastery: Hands-On Machine Learning" offers a focused, practical approach to mastering the Scikit-Learn library, emphasizing recent techniques and efficient workflows. Rupesh Kumar Tipu distills essential machine learning concepts into actionable tutorials, from data cleaning to advanced ensemble and neural network strategies. This compact guide is tailored for professionals and enthusiasts aiming to strengthen their hands-on skills with Scikit-Learn’s tools and boost project outcomes. If you want a straightforward resource that cuts to the core of Scikit-Learn’s capabilities, this book fills that niche well.
2024·56 pages·Scikit Learn, Machine Learning, Data Science, Model Evaluation, Ensemble Learning

After exploring the limitations of many machine learning resources, Rupesh Kumar Tipu developed this focused guide on leveraging the Scikit-Learn library effectively. You’ll gain hands-on experience with core techniques like data preprocessing, model construction, evaluation metrics, and advanced topics including ensemble methods and neural networks. The book’s concise 56 pages concentrate on practical implementation, making it a solid pick if you want to build and optimize models without wading through unnecessary theory. While it’s accessible enough for enthusiasts, professionals seeking a quick, applied reference for Scikit-Learn will find it particularly useful.

View on Amazon

Stay Ahead: Get Your Custom 2025 Scikit Learn Guide

Master the latest Scikit Learn strategies and research without reading endless books.

Personalized learning paths
Targeted skill building
Up-to-date insights

Trusted by forward-thinking machine learning professionals worldwide

2025 Scikit Learn Revolution
Tomorrow’s Scikit Learn Blueprint
Scikit Learn Trend Secrets
90-Day Scikit Learn Mastery

Conclusion

These seven books collectively emphasize three vital themes: the importance of domain-tailored feature engineering, bridging Python programming with practical machine learning workflows, and mastering advanced predictive modeling techniques. They reflect an industry increasingly focused on actionable skills and real-world application over abstract theory.

If you want to stay ahead of the latest research and trends, start with "Feature Engineering for Modern Machine Learning with Scikit-Learn" and "Practical Machine Learning with Python and Scikit-Learn" to build foundational skills and practical expertise. For cutting-edge implementation of predictive models, combine "Ultimate Machine Learning with Scikit-Learn" and "Machine Learning" tailored for finance.

Alternatively, you can create a personalized Scikit Learn book to apply the newest strategies and latest research to your specific situation. These books offer the most current 2025 insights and can help you stay ahead of the curve in Scikit Learn.

Frequently Asked Questions

I'm overwhelmed by choice – which book should I start with?

Start with "Practical Machine Learning with Python and Scikit-Learn" for a solid foundation in Python-based ML. It balances theory and hands-on practice, making it a great entry point before exploring more specialized texts like feature engineering or finance applications.

Are these books too advanced for someone new to Scikit Learn?

Not really. Books like "Scikit-Learn Mastery" provide concise, practical introductions suitable for beginners, while others gradually build complexity. You can pick based on your current skill level and grow into the more advanced topics at your own pace.

What's the best order to read these books?

Begin with broad practical guides such as "Practical Machine Learning with Python and Scikit-Learn," then move to specialized books like "Feature Engineering for Modern Machine Learning with Scikit-Learn." Finally, explore advanced topics in predictive modeling with "Ultimate Machine Learning with Scikit-Learn."

Do these books assume I already have experience in Scikit Learn?

Some do, especially those focusing on advanced techniques like feature engineering or predictive modeling. However, books like "Scikit-Learn" by Mikhail Agladze cover fundamentals clearly, making them accessible for those with basic Python knowledge.

Which book gives the most actionable advice I can use right away?

"Practical Machine Learning with Python and Scikit-Learn" offers immediate, hands-on code examples and practical workflows, perfect for applying skills quickly to real-world problems.

Can I get personalized Scikit Learn insights tailored to my goals?

Yes! While these expert-authored books are invaluable, personalized content complements them by focusing on your specific needs. You can create a personalized Scikit Learn book that adapts the latest strategies directly to your background and objectives, keeping you current and efficient.

📚 Love this book list?

Help fellow book lovers discover great books, share this curated list with others!